Zodiacal Light and Skyglow

At first glance this image just shows the orange glow of light pollution on the horizon. However the neutral colour of the Zodiacal Light, extending upwards and leftwards through the middle of the image, shows that it is not the same thing. The colour difference wasn't perceptible to the eye but being able to sweep the eye across the area made it easier to distinguish Zodiacal Light from the background.

Combining two images allows more of the sky to be shown and the contrast between the Zodiacal Light and the rest of the sky becomes more apparent.
